Letter tokenizer
editThe letter tokenizer breaks text into terms whenever it encounters a
character which is not a letter. It does a reasonable job for most European
languages, but does a terrible job for some Asian languages, where words are
not separated by spaces.

POST _analyze
{
"tokenizer": "letter",
"text": "The 2 QUICK Brown-Foxes jumped over the lazy dog's bone."
}
The above sentence would produce the following terms:
[ The, QUICK, Brown, Foxes, jumped, over, the, lazy, dog, s, bone ]
Configuration
editThe letter tokenizer is not configurable.
